mart1nN
V2EX  ›  Java

maven 管理的 web 项目中关于依赖的问题

  •  
  •   mart1nN · Jun 4, 2019 · 2661 views
    This topic created in 2546 days ago, the information mentioned may be changed or developed.

    是这样,我新建了一个 maven 项目(称为 a ),之后又在这个 maven 项目中 new 了一个 web 项目的 module (称为 b ),b 中是没有 pom.xml 文件的。我在 a 的 pom.xml 中添加依赖 junit,发现在 b 中无法找到 junit 的包。在不考虑向 b 中手动添加 pom.xml 的情况下,请问各位师傅我应该怎么做

    4 replies    2019-06-04 10:32:06 +08:00
    zvcs
        1
    zvcs  
       Jun 4, 2019 via Android
    修改 classpath 不过你用的 spring 的话会碰到打不了包问题。搞来搞去还是得改 pom
    woshiaha
        2
    woshiaha  
       Jun 4, 2019
    规范点啊 b 作为子项目也应该有自己的 pom
    sodadev
        3
    sodadev  
       Jun 4, 2019 via iPhone
    可以考虑配制成聚合工程,但子项目依旧要写 pom
    palmers
        4
    palmers  
       Jun 4, 2019
    这不是老项目 存在历史遗留问题 为啥还这么不规范? 你的问题规范操作后自然就解决了
    About   ·   Help   ·   Advertise   ·   Blog   ·   API   ·   FAQ   ·   Solana   ·   1691 Online   Highest 6679   ·     Select Language
    创意工作者们的社区
    World is powered by solitude
    VERSION: 3.9.8.5 · 68ms · UTC 16:26 · PVG 00:26 · LAX 09:26 · JFK 12:26
    ♥ Do have faith in what you're doing.